Nous recommandons d’utiliser Visual Studio 2017

isleadbyte, _isleadbyte_l

 

Date de publication : novembre 2016

Pour obtenir la dernière documentation sur Visual Studio 2017, consultez Documentation Visual Studio 2017.

Détermine si un caractère est l’octet de tête d’un caractère multioctet.

System_CAPS_ICON_important.jpg Important

Cette API ne peut pas être utilisée dans les applications qui s’exécutent dans le Windows Runtime. Pour plus d’informations, consultez Fonctions CRT non prises en charge avec /ZW.

int isleadbyte(  
   int c   
);  
int _isleadbyte_l(  
   int c   
);  

Paramètres

c
Entier à tester.

isleadbyteRetourne une valeur différente de zéro si l’argument satisfait la condition de test ou 0 si elle n’est pas le cas. Dans les paramètres régionaux « C » et dans les paramètres régionaux SBCS (jeu de caractères codés sur un octet), isleadbyte retourne toujours 0.

La macro isleadbyte retourne une valeur différente de zéro si son argument est le premier octet d’un caractère multioctet. isleadbyteproduit un résultat significatif pour n’importe quel argument entier entre –&1; (EOF) à UCHAR_MAX (0xFF), inclus.

Le type d’argument attendu de isleadbyte est int. Si un caractère signé est passé, le compilateur est susceptible de le convertir en un entier par extension de signe, aboutissant à des résultats imprévisibles.

La version de cette fonction avec le suffixe _l est identique, excepté qu’il utilise les paramètres régionaux passés au lieu des paramètres régionaux actuels pour son comportement dépendant des paramètres régionaux.

Mappages de routines de texte générique

Routine TCHAR.H_UNICODE et _MBCS non définis_MBCS défini_UNICODE défini
_istleadbyteRetourne toujours la valeur false_ isleadbyteRetourne toujours la valeur false
RoutineEn-tête requis
isleadbyte<ctype.h>
_isleadbyte_l<ctype.h>

Pour plus d'informations sur la compatibilité, voir Compatibilité.

Non applicable, mais consultez System::Globalization::CultureInfo.

Classification d’octets
Paramètres régionaux
_ismbb (routines)

Afficher: